According to IADB website, the objective of this transaction is to increase access to financing for small and medium enterprises and female retail clients in Panama, by creating and implementing a holistic value proposition which will support the growth of Global Bank's women and SME portfolios. To do this, IDB Invest is proposing a Senior Unsecured Loan of approximately US$ 160 million to Global Bank Corporation comprised by:
(i) A Loan of up to US$60 million to be funded by IDB Invest; and
(ii) IDB Invest B Loan expected to be of approximately US$100 million, to be funded through the sale of participations to commercial lenders.

Global Bank Corporation provides commercial and consumer banking services in the Republic of Panama and internationally. It operates through Banking and Financial Activities, Insurance, and Pension and Severance Funds segments.

ACCOUNTABILITY MECHANISM OF IADB
The Independent Consultation and Investigation Mechanism (MICI) is the independent complaint mechanism and fact-finding body for people who have been or are likely to be adversely affected by an Inter-American Development Bank (IDB) or Inter-American Investment Corporation (IIC)-funded project. If you submit a complaint to MICI, they may assist you in addressing the problems you raised through a dispute-resolution process with those implementing the project and/or through an investigation to assess whether the IDB or IIC is following its own policies for preventing or mitigating harm to people or the environment.
